Table 3‑6. Custom Properties I Table (Continued)
Property Definition
Image.WIM.Path
Specifies the UNC path to the WIM file from which an image is extracted during WIM-
based provisioning. The path format is \\server\share$ format, for example \\lab-
ad\dfs$.
Image.WIM.Name
Specifies the name of the WIM file, for example win2k8.wim, as located by the
Image.WIM.Path property.
Image.WIM.Index
Specifies the index used to extract the correct image from the WIM file.
Image.Network.User
Specifies the user name with which to map the WIM image path (Image.WIM.Path) to
a network drive on the provisioned machine. This is typically a domain account with
access to the network share.
Image.Network.Password
Specifies the password associated with the Image.Network.User property.
Image.Network.Letter
Specifies the drive letter to which the WIM image path is mapped on the provisioned
machine. The default value is K.
Infrastructure.Admin.MachineObject
OU
Specifies the organizational unit (OU) of the machine. When machines are placed in
the required OU by the business group OU setting, this property is not required.
Infrastructure.Admin.ADUser
Specifies the domain administrator user ID. This identifier is used to query Active
Directory users and groups when an anonymous bind cannot be used.
Infrastructure.Admin.ADPassword
Specifies the password associated with the Infrastructure.Admin.ADUser domain
administrator user ID.
Infrastructure.Admin.DefaultDomain
Specifies the default domain on the machine.
Infrastructure.ResourcePool.Name
Specifies the resource pool to which the machine belongs, if any. The default is the
value specified in the reservation from which the machine was provisioned.
Custom Properties L Table
This section lists vRealize Automation custom properties that begin with the letter L.
Table 3‑7. Custom Properties L Table
Property Description
Linux.ExternalScript.LocationType
Specifies the location type of the customization script named in the
Linux.ExternalScript.Name property. This can be either local or
nfs.
You must also specify the script location using the
Linux.ExternalScript.Path property. If the location type is nfs,
also use the Linux.ExternalScript.Server property.
Linux.ExternalScript.Name
Specifies the name of an optional customization script, for example
config.sh, that the Linux guest agent runs after the operating system
is installed. This property is available for Linux machines cloned from
templates on which the Linux agent is installed.
If you specify an external script, you must also define its location by
using the Linux.ExternalScript.LocationType and
Linux.ExternalScript.Path properties.
